Database Developer (Software House- SQL Server/Oracle)

Job Description

A software company is currently looking for a Junior to Mid-Level Database Developer who is self-driven and enthusiastic to become part of their team. The chosen candidate will work closely with the development team to create, enhance, and maintain the company's database systems through designing, testing, and developing them.

Responsibilities:

  • Design, develop, test and maintain database systems
  • Develop and maintain database schemas, tables, and stored procedures
  • Collaborate with cross-functional teams to identify and implement database solutions
  • Ensure database performance, security, and scalability
  • Troubleshoot and resolve database issues
  • Create and maintain documentation related to database design and functionality

Requirements:

  • Bachelor's degree in Computer Science or related field
  • 1-3 years of experience in database development
  • Experience with relational databases such as MySQL, Oracle, or SQL Server
  • Knowledge of SQL and database design principles
  • Experience with data modeling, ETL processes, and database optimization techniques
  • Familiarity with database management tools and frameworks
  • Strong problem-solving skills and attention to detail
  • Ability to work independently and collaboratively in a team environment

Preferred Qualifications:

  • Experience with NoSQL databases such as MongoDB
  • Familiarity with cloud-based database solutions such as AWS RDS or Azure SQL Database
  • Knowledge of software development methodologies such as Agile or Scrum

The firm offer a competitive salary package along with opportunities for growth and advancement within the company. If you are a self-starter with a passion for database development and a desire to work in a dynamic and innovative environment.

If you are interested in this position or any other role in Data Engineering, Data Science or Data Warehousing, please contact Rachel Boyle directly on LinkedIn.